What Is a Custom Bolt?

A custom bolt is a specially designed fastener manufactured according to specific customer requirements, including size, thread type, material, strength grade, head design, and surface finish. Compared with standard bolts, a custom bolt provides better performance for applications requiring unique structures, high strength, corrosion resistance, or precise assembly.

Custom Bolt Materials:

Polestar manufactures high-performance fasteners using a wide range of materials:

Stainless Steel:

  • 304, 316, 17-4PH stainless steel
  • Excellent corrosion resistance and long service life

Carbon Steel & Alloy Steel:

  • 1018, 1045, 4140, 4340 steel
  • High strength and wear resistance for heavy-duty applications

Aluminum Alloy:

  • 6061, 7075 aluminum
  • Lightweight and corrosion resistant

Titanium Alloy:

  • Grade 2 Titanium
  • Grade 5 Titanium (Ti-6Al-4V)
  • Superior strength-to-weight ratio

Special Alloys:

  • Inconel
  • Nickel A286
  • Nimonic 80A
  • Suitable for high-temperature environments
